A new prescribed burn, called Jasper 1076, was initiated 9:45 a.m. March 12 in Jasper County, Texas.

Since it was initiated seven months ago, the prescribed fire has burned 90 acres of federal land managed by the U.S. Department of Defence.

Prescribed fire (prescribed burn) is a wildfire prevention method that involves burning an area of land in a controlled manner to minimize the risk of catastrophic wildfires.
